We investigate influence of the laser efficiency due to the pump-induced loss in a Ti:sapphire laser crystal. We experimentally reveal the increase of the pump-induced loss due to difference of pump wavelength in Ti:sapphire laser. As a factor of the loss increase, we assumed the loss increases in proportion to pump intensity, and the loss was theoretically analyzed. By optimizing pump beam, laser beam and output coupling, we show that blue-diode-pumped Ti:sapphire laser can prevent the decrease of the laser efficiency. |
